Firefighter Salary in Oklahoma

Firefighters in Oklahoma earn an average of $51,244 per year across 1 metro area. This is +10.3% lower than the national average.

After adjusting for Oklahoma's cost of living (below average), a Firefighter's salary of $51,244 has the purchasing power of $58,901 in an average-cost area.

What is the average Firefighter salary in Oklahoma?

The average Firefighter salary in Oklahoma is $51,244 per year ($24.64/hour) based on 2026 data across 1 metro areas. This is 10.3% below the national average of $57,120.

What is the highest paying city for Firefighters in Oklahoma?

Oklahoma City, OK is the highest paying city for Firefighters in Oklahoma, with a median salary of $51,244 per year.

What is the salary range for Firefighters in Oklahoma?

Firefighter salaries in Oklahoma range from $34,204 (entry-level, 10th percentile) to $75,226 (experienced, 90th percentile). The median salary is $51,244 per year.

About This Data

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ey. State-level averages are calculated from metro area data within Oklahoma. Figures represent 2026 estimates and may not reflect all employers or self-employed workers. Cost of living adjustments use regional indices to provide purchasing power context.
